Transaction Monitoring and Danger Scoring on Blockchain
One of the efficient methods to fight monetary crime in Web3 is thru real-time transaction monitoring and danger scoring. Blockchain transactions might be analyzed to detect suspicious patterns, with risk-scoring fashions assigning ranges of concern based mostly on elements similar to supply of funds, transaction measurement, frequency, and pockets associations. Automated alerts flag high-risk transactions for additional investigation, serving to compliance groups and regulators reply swiftly to potential threats.
A number of blockchain analytics corporations have developed subtle instruments to assist these efforts. KYT (Know Your Transaction) is a typical instance which employs machine studying to establish high-risk transactions and monitor illicit pockets actions, and such device also can monitor transactions throughout a number of blockchains to uncover suspicious conduct. Actual-time danger scoring can be attainable for recognizing and categorizing completely different monetary establishments engaged in crypto transactions for crucial acceptable due diligence and management measures by way of shopper onboarding consideration and ongoing transaction monitoring and investigation.
Regardless of these developments, transaction monitoring on blockchain nonetheless faces challenges. Many wallets should not linked to real-world identities, making it tough to hint the last word beneficiaries of suspicious exercise. Criminals steadily use obfuscation strategies, similar to layering transactions throughout a number of wallets and chains, which complicates detection. Moreover, false positives stay a priority, probably inserting pointless compliance burdens on reliable customers. Whereas blockchain-based monitoring considerably enhances AML efforts, integrating these instruments with off-chain KYC measures is crucial for making certain correct danger assessments.
On-Chain Analytics and Forensic Investigation
Forensic investigation within the blockchain area depends on analyzing transaction histories to establish hyperlinks between illicit addresses and monetary crimes. Investigators make the most of graph-based visualizations to trace fund flows throughout a number of wallets and chains, whereas heuristics and clustering strategies assist deanonymize pockets house owners. These strategies are significantly helpful in tracing cryptocurrency actions related to darknet markets, fraud schemes, and sanctioned entities.
Main forensic instruments, generally developed and provdied by respected KYT distributors, can present regulation enforcement businesses and monetary establishments with the power to hint illicit transactions and predict monetary crime dangers. These instruments have performed a vital position in recovering stolen funds and aiding investigations into crypto-related monetary crimes.
Nevertheless, forensic tracing within the cryptocurrency area isn’t with out important limitations. Privateness-centric cryptocurrencies similar to Monero and Zcash, together with obfuscation instruments like Twister Money, pose substantial challenges for investigators by concealing transaction origins and locations. The growing use of cross-chain transactions additional complicates the tracing course of, as property might be moved fluidly throughout blockchains with various levels of transparency and oversight.
Though on-chain analytics instruments have made appreciable progress in figuring out suspicious patterns and addresses, their effectiveness is constrained with out regulatory cooperation — significantly from DeFi platforms and privacy-oriented blockchain tasks. These gaps in compliance proceed to create exploitable blind spots within the broader digital asset ecosystem.
A crucial concern that deserves additional emphasis is the position of centralized cryptocurrency exchanges themselves. Appearing successfully as large-scale “mixers,” exchanges combination crypto inflows into inner wallets, after which outgoing transfers can now not be reliably linked to their authentic sources. That is as a result of creation and use of quite a few pockets addresses throughout the alternate’s inner ledger system, that are neither publicly disclosed nor externally auditable. Because of this, as soon as funds enter such an alternate, forensic tracing typically reaches a useless finish — undermining transparency and hindering enforcement efforts.
Deal with Screening and Pockets Danger Profiling
One other crucial AML device within the blockchain area is pockets danger profiling, the place crypto wallets are assessed based mostly on transaction historical past and flagged if linked to illicit actions similar to sanctions evasion, fraud, or darknet transactions. Digital Asset Service Suppliers (VASPs) and monetary establishments combine these danger databases to stop high-risk wallets from participating in transactions.
At present, respected distributors provide pockets screening instruments that enable exchanges and monetary establishments to make extra knowledgeable compliance selections. These options assist detect and forestall interactions with recognized illicit actors, whereas additionally supporting automated enforcement of inner compliance insurance policies.
Nevertheless, pockets screening isn’t with out its shortcomings. Malicious actors can simply generate new wallets to evade detection, and lots of illicit transactions could contain wallets which have but to be flagged, limiting the general effectiveness of screening alone. Moreover, false positives stay a priority, as they will unintentionally limit entry to monetary companies for reliable customers. This underscores the significance of constantly refining risk-scoring algorithms to enhance accuracy and cut back unintended affect.
Equally vital is the continuing upkeep of the databases that underpin these instruments. Distributors should guarantee well timed updates and strong accuracy checks to take care of the reliability and relevance of pockets intelligence in a fast-changing risk surroundings.
